new here, Howdy!
 
hi, all new here names Jim. i have a losi mrc, done couple things to it so far bent links in front (had them in back but didn't like it), threaded shocks, 1/10 servo, added weight in between the spokes of the wheels, removed the foam from tires and add split shot inside of tires "thumbsup", cut my battery plate and flipped the shocks in, moved the battery over the front shocks, trimmed back the body mounts two holes and use o-rings to keep the body on got tried of loosing body clips think that about it so far. at the moment it's a 3wd broke i cracked a stripped the one side of the rear locker but i swapped it to the front so the rear in locked again. :lmao:
